Minimum Academic Requirements for 2026
Before starting your TUT nursing diploma application, you must meet the academic thresholds set for 2026 admissions. These include:
Requirement | Details |
---|---|
APS (Admission Point Score) | Minimum of 26 with Mathematics or Technical Mathematics |
OR a minimum of 28 with Mathematical Literacy | |
Language Proficiency | A strong pass in English (Home Language or First Additional Language) |
Grade 12 Certificate | Certified copy of final results or National Senior Certificate (NSC) |
It’s essential to ensure that your subject choices and marks align with the programme’s specific requirements. Applicants with strong Life Sciences, Physical Sciences, or Health-related subjects have an added advantage.
TUT Nursing Application Process 2026
Applying to TUT is straightforward if you follow each step carefully. Here’s how to complete your TUT application for nursing diploma courses:
1. Visit the TUT Online Application Portal
Start your journey by heading to the official TUT website. Locate the “Apply Online” section, which provides access to the application portal and relevant information.
2. Confirm Your Eligibility
Double-check that you meet the academic and subject requirements for the nursing diploma. Failing to meet the minimum criteria may result in your application being declined.
3. Fill in the Online Application Form
Complete the TUT nursing application form with accurate personal and academic information. Make sure your ID number, contact details, and subject marks are correctly entered.
4. Upload All Required Supporting Documents
You must upload certified copies of the following:
- Grade 12 Certificate or final Grade 12 results
- South African ID or proof of citizenship (if applicable)
- Any other supporting documents requested by TUT
Ensure that all documents are clear and recently certified (within 3 months).
5. Pay the Application Fee
A non-refundable application fee is mandatory for processing. Once you’ve paid via the TUT banking details provided on the site, upload your proof of payment to the portal.
Note: Late applications are generally not accepted, so be sure to apply during the official opening dates.
Application Timeline for TUT Nursing Diploma 2026
While official dates may vary slightly each year, here’s an estimated timeline based on previous application cycles:
Application Phase | Estimated Timeframe |
---|---|
Online Applications Open | April to May 2025 |
Closing Date for Applications | September 2025 |
Admission Selections & Offers | October – December 2025 |
Orientation & Registration | January – February 2026 |
Keep monitoring the TUT website for official 2026 nursing application deadlines and notifications.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the minimum APS required for the TUT nursing diploma?
A: You need an APS of at least 26 with Mathematics or 28 with Mathematical Literacy.
Q2: Can I apply with Grade 12 results if I haven’t received my NSC yet?
A: Yes, provisional applications are allowed with your Grade 12 results. Final acceptance depends on meeting the requirements.
Q3: Is there an application fee for TUT nursing courses?
A: Yes, a non-refundable fee is required. Proof of payment must be submitted with your application.
Q4: When is the TUT application closing date for nursing in 2026?
A: The expected closing date is around September 2025, but check the official site for confirmation.
Q5: Can foreign nationals apply for the TUT nursing diploma?
A: Yes, but they must provide proof of legal residence and equivalent academic qualifications.
